Russian President Vladimir Putin ordered his govt to make sure retail fuel prices stabilize and urged additional measures to balance the domestic market following the introduction of a ban on gasoline and diesel exports. Putin told the cabinet it needed to act swiftly and that reviewing oil industry taxes was an option.
